HB 693 Aggravating Factors for Capital Felonies (2025 Session)
Aggravating Factors for Capital Felonies: Provides additional aggravating factor for sentencing for capital felonies if victim was gathered with one or more persons for specified activities. Effective Date: October 1, 2025
